Pandora hires new VP of industry relations

Pandora cube canvas 160wPandora announced that Lars Murray will serve as its new vice president of industry relations. Murray joins the company from Columbia Records, where he was vice president of digital media. He was responsible for the digital marketing operations behind recent successful albums such as Random Access Memories by Daft Punk, GIRL by Pharrell Williams, and Lazaretto by Jack White.

In the new position, which takes effect immediately, Murray will be tasked with leading Pandora’s strategic collaborations with other stakeholders in the music business. His connections and past experience working with artists could be a help in getting musicians to make the most of Pandora’s digital service.

The press release noted that Pandora is looking “to further leverage its scale and unique technology to create even more opportunity and value for artists, labels and the entire music ecosystem.” Murray’s specific set of skills in the digital universe and in the label environment could be a sign of how Pandora wants to interact with the production side of music.
